Over the past year or so, the whole of the fenestration industry has come to acknowledge the continuing skills gap which exists in this market, so it’s encouraging to see so many new programmes and initiatives being announced which are designed to start addressing that.

It’s obviously up to the biggest players in the market to step up and lead the way, and we’re proud to say that AluK is doing exactly that.

Our Chepstow Training Academy is one of the most impressive in the industry. Set in the heart of our production facility, it is a 3000sq ft space equipped with all the latest Emmegi machinery to reflect most typical fabrication set ups.

Here, our technical team deliver a whole programme of regular training courses aimed at designers, fabricators and installers of our aluminium window, door and curtain walling systems. Our aim is to promote best practice across the whole supply chain and we’re making it as easy as we can for our customers to acquire the skills they need.

We have just announced our schedule of courses for 2019, and they are all open to anyone using AluK products and, crucially, all are entirely free. There are more than 20 options to choose from on the fabrication and installation of our complete product range, and on designing the systems using LogiKal software. They combine product awareness with plenty of practical hands on training and tackle all the issues you might face either onsite or in the factory.

11 of the courses of the 21 courses are already GQA accredited and we expect the rest of them to be accredited by the end of 2019. You can see the full schedule here at www.alukacademy.co.uk with all the dates and times for the year ahead, and it’s quick and easy to book online.
